Bayern Munich winger Kingsley Koeman underwent minor surgical procedure this week to right a coronary heart drawback, however just isn’t anticipated to be out for greater than two weeks, Bayern coach Julian Nagelsmann mentioned on Friday.

The Frenchman, who got here in as a late substitute in his 3-0 Champions League group-stage win at Barcelona earlier this week, will resume coaching early subsequent week after going below the knife on Thursday.

“He had a faint extra heartbeat, a minor hearth rhythm issue,” Nagelsmann advised a digital information convention. “He had a little less air. So we decided to have surgery. He was operated on yesterday.”

“From Tuesday he’ll begin cardio coaching and won’t be out for greater than every week and a half or two. It’s not that critical. Many individuals have this drawback. He feels effectively, has no ache.”
